Steve AI 开源项目教程
steveSteVe - OCPP server implementation in Java项目地址:https://gitcode.com/gh_mirrors/st/steve
项目介绍
Steve AI 是一个基于人工智能的视频生成工具,它允许用户通过简单的文本输入快速创建高质量的视频内容。该项目旨在帮助非专业用户轻松地将他们的想法转化为吸引人的视频,即使他们没有专业的视频编辑技能。Steve AI 提供了多种视频类型,包括动画、实拍、混合等,支持用户自定义文本、图像和音频。
项目快速启动
安装
首先,克隆项目仓库到本地:
git clone https://github.com/steve-community/steve.git
cd steve
配置
安装所需的依赖包:
pip install -r requirements.txt
运行
启动项目:
python app.py
使用示例
以下是一个简单的使用示例,展示如何通过文本生成视频:
from steve_ai import VideoGenerator
# 初始化视频生成器
generator = VideoGenerator()
# 输入文本
text = "欢迎使用 Steve AI,让我们一起创造精彩的视频内容!"
# 生成视频
video_path = generator.generate_video(text)
print(f"视频已生成,路径为: {video_path}")
应用案例和最佳实践
教育领域
Steve AI 可以用于创建教育视频,帮助教师将复杂的概念转化为易于理解的视频内容。例如,数学老师可以使用 Steve AI 制作动态的数学公式演示视频,提高学生的学习兴趣。
营销推广
企业可以使用 Steve AI 快速制作产品介绍视频,通过社交媒体进行推广。例如,一家新创公司可以使用 Steve AI 制作产品发布视频,吸引潜在客户的注意。
个人创作
个人用户可以使用 Steve AI 制作生日祝福、婚礼邀请等个性化视频。例如,用户可以通过输入简单的文本和选择模板,快速生成一个独特的生日祝福视频。
典型生态项目
Steve AI 社区
Steve AI 社区是一个活跃的开源社区,提供了丰富的资源和教程,帮助用户更好地使用和贡献项目。社区成员可以分享他们的使用经验、提出问题和建议,共同推动项目的发展。
Steve AI 插件
Steve AI 支持多种插件扩展,用户可以根据自己的需求开发和使用插件。例如,一个视频编辑插件可以帮助用户进一步优化生成的视频内容,添加特效和过渡效果。
Steve AI 集成
Steve AI 可以与其他项目和平台集成,扩展其功能。例如,与内容管理系统(CMS)集成,用户可以直接在 CMS 中生成和发布视频内容,提高工作效率。
通过以上教程,您可以快速了解和使用 Steve AI 开源项目,开始您的视频创作之旅!
steveSteVe - OCPP server implementation in Java项目地址:https://gitcode.com/gh_mirrors/st/steve